Maxis To Launches iPhone 4 On 26 September

Finally, it is here.  iPhone 4 is officially hit our shores  through Maxis beginning 26th September and available nationwide the following day. All phones comes mandatory with data and sms/call plan with 12/24 months contract (sorry no prepaid at the moment). The lowest one,  iValue 1 has 1GB data, 333 minutes local talktime and 250 sms all for RM100.

As for the iPhone 4 price itself is vary, it depend on how long the contract and how much you pay monthly. It is even free if you subscribe iValue 4 for 2 years. Of all, iValue1 is the most affordable package and with 2 years contract, it could be yours from RM1390. This the source link for more information.

Celcom Raya Phone Sale Halves Some Smartphone Price

Celcom Raya promo Celcom Raya Phone Sale Halves Some Smartphone Price

Eid Mubaraq or Raya had just passed a week ago, though the Raya mood still going strong with lots of open house to attend. Anyhow, for those that cut their online activity off like me, I just figure out the Raya phone sale from Celcom.But do not expect huge cut although the ads claim the 1/2 price off.

The price advertised on their printed and website is the normal subsidized price (because of the the contract, usually 12 months) with additional price cut. For instance, originally Blackberry Cuve 9300 is priced at Rm688 with RM250 monthly commitment for 1 year, but with this promotion, there is additional RM100 off. Not bad, but somehow it is quite misleading for frequent visitor to their website like me. It’s true there is price cut but it is marketing tactic after all, right? Hit the source link for the deal.

Digi To Launch iPhone 4 Next Week?

Digi iPhone4 Digi To Launch iPhone 4 Next Week?

The latest email from Digi sent today reveal that Digi will launch iPhone 4 next week. The exact date is still unknown but Digi promise to release more update in coming days. This update brought an end to the endless speculation about when iPhone will finally hit our shores. But do you think it’s already late?

It took almost 2 months for the iPhone 4 launch to materialize since pre-registration opened in July. I always wondering why it took so long for iPhone and iPad to be launch here, unlike other Apple devices such as Macbook or iPod. During this period, grey importer has brought iPhone 4 from countries such as Singapore and Hong Kong with very competitive price. This will cannibalizing iPhone 4 sales from both carriers, Digi and Maxis in the long run.

But well, there is still demand for iPhone 4 from users who prefer the subsidized phone with contract. And Maxis, I believe they will not stay silent upon seeing this update from Digi. How soon they will react is still to be seen, but I strongly believe they will launch iPhone 4 next week as well. Suddenly iPhone 4 become center of attention once again.
